Noita is a magical action roguelite set in a world where every pixel is physically simulated. Fight, explore, melt, burn, freeze and evaporate your way through the procedurally generated world using spells you've created yourself. Explore a variety of environments ranging from coal mines to freezing wastelands while delving deeper in search for unknown mysteries.

Borderlands looting with a tabletop-fantasy skin: spells replace grenades, melee matters, and the class system lets you mix two trees. The overworld map is a genuinely different way to move between areas. It is short by series standards, and the endgame collapses into one repeatable dungeon that gets old well before the loot chase does.

Fast melee-and-guns combat with a genuinely good katana feel, built around procedurally assembled open levels and four-player co-op. Movement is quick and mobile. The procedural generation is the cost: environments repeat visibly after a few hours, and the loot-driven stat progression sits awkwardly on a game whose shooting is otherwise built on precision.
